Posted by: exposito at Fri May 30 08:36:43 2008 [ Email Message ] [ Show All Posts by exposito ] Usually if we have a slow starter we will cool them with the adults. This usually jump starts their appetite. This guy has always eaten a little bit at a time, but he ate 3 pinks last night. We do not use the runts of a clutch as breeding stock. We sell them as pet quality snakes at a discounted price. This guy is out of a very aberrant line and he did not appear to be a runt when he was purchased. He just has not grown very much. As far as size and morphs goes, we have not noticed any link between size and color morph. | ||
